Endpoint
Total cholesterol (TC)
CAT:outcome/total-cholesterolreported in mg/dL
Method
Serum or plasma total cholesterol (TC) concentration by clinical enzymatic cholesterol-oxidase assay.
The method is part of the endpoint identity. Studies measuring the same quantity by a different method are held as separate endpoints.
Notes
Confusable with LDL cholesterol, and the confusion is not benign: this value is the SUM of the LDL, HDL and VLDL fractions, so it is independent of neither. An intervention that raises HDL-C while lowering LDL-C can leave this number flat, and one that raises HDL-C alone pushes it in the apparently harmful direction — PMID 39647241 shows exactly that pattern. PARTIAL SIGN CONFLICT with HDL cholesterol for that reason: HDL improving by RISING drags this endpoint the way its own direction of benefit calls harm. Never substitute for LDL-C in either direction.

resveratrol — no detected effect on
Well establishedGrade A, Well established. Replicated human trial evidence, consistent direction.FindingNull result“The pooled effect estimate revealed no effect of resveratrol on cholesterol (MD = -5.91; 95% CI [-18.54, 6.72], P = 0.36).”
Quoted verbatim from Efficacy of resveratrol in women with polycystic ovary syndrome: a systematic review and meta-analysis of randomized clinical trials.. - Study
- meta-analysis
- Participants
- 108
- Dose
- 1000 or 1500 mg/day oral resveratrol
- Population
- Women with polycystic ovary syndrome; 2 pooled RCTs, resveratrol vs placebo
Effect -5.91 mean difference, 95% CI -18.54 to 6.72
Efficacy of resveratrol in women with polycystic ovary syndrome: a systematic review and meta-analysis of randomized clinical trials.2023PMID:37333786
melatonin — decreases
LikelyGrade B, Likely. Human evidence, limited replication or design limits.Finding“The meta-analysis indicated that melatonin supplementation significantly reduced serum TC (WMD: −6.97 mg/dL, 95% CI: −12.20, −1.74) and LDL-C levels (WMD: −6.28 mg/dL, 95% CI: −10.53, −2.03) in the melatonin group compared with the control group.”
Quoted verbatim from Comprehensive Effects of Melatonin Supplementation on Cardiometabolic Risk Factors: A Systematic Review and Dose-Response Meta-Analysis.. - Study
- meta-analysis
- Dose
- 0.3-100 mg/day oral
- Population
- adults in 63 RCTs of melatonin supplementation vs placebo across mixed clinical populations
Effect -6.97 mean difference, 95% CI -12.2 to -1.74
Comprehensive Effects of Melatonin Supplementation on Cardiometabolic Risk Factors: A Systematic Review and Dose-Response Meta-Analysis.2025PMID:41515249
curcumin — decreases
LikelyGrade B, Likely. Human evidence, limited replication or design limits.Finding“Curcumin supplementation resulted in a significant reduction in total cholesterol and LDL-C levels when compared to the placebo group at the 6, 9, and 12-month time points.”
Quoted verbatim from Curcumin Attenuates Liver Steatosis via Antioxidant and Anti-Inflammatory Pathways in Obese Patients with Type 2 Diabetes Mellitus: A Randomized Controlled Trial.. - Study
- RCT
- Duration
- 12 months
- Dose
- Oral ethanolic Curcuma longa rhizome extract standardised to 75-85% total curcuminoids, 250 mg curcuminoids per capsule, three capsules twice daily (1500 mg curcuminoids/day) for 12 months
- Population
- Obese adults with type 2 diabetes mellitus managed on metformin (age >=35 y, BMI >=23 kg/m2, HbA1c <6.5%), Nakhon Nayok, Thailand; 227 randomised, per-protocol analysis and the analysed count is not reported in the paper; secondary endpoint (declared primary outcome: liver steatosis by controlled attenuation parameter on transient elastography)
Curcumin Attenuates Liver Steatosis via Antioxidant and Anti-Inflammatory Pathways in Obese Patients with Type 2 Diabetes Mellitus: A Randomized Controlled Trial.2025PMID:41096556Industry funded
